This macro command should be excuted after the parameter protection function is
enabled. When parameter protection function is disabled, if this marco command is
excuted again, the failure code will be sent back.
If input the incorrect password, the failure code, Ennn will be sent back. The number
nnn represents the retry times for password input. The number nnn will decrease 1
every time after inputting the incorrect password. When the number nnn cannot be
decreased, it means the password is locked and cannot be removed anymore.

Create E-Cam table: for rotary cutoff application, including
sealing zone (7 areas)
P5-81: Start Address of Data Array for E-Cam table.
P5-82: E-Cam Area Number. Set P5-82 to 7 (7 areas, 8 points).
P1-44, P1-45: Electronic Gear Ratio (must be set first)
P5-94=A (Deceleration Ratio: Numerator) x C (Knife Number)
P5-95=B (Deceleration Ratio: Denominator)
P5-96= 1000000 x R x V
R (Cut Ratio) = L (Cut Length) / ℓ (Knife Circumference)
The normal cut ratio is the multiple of 0.3 ~ 2.5.
V (Speed Compensation) = (Target Cut Speed) / (Product
Speed)
When V=1.0, the speed of knife is the same as the product
during cutting operation.
When V=1.1, the speed of knife will be increased 10%.
When V=0.9, the speed of knife will be decreased 10%
and so on.
